Question:
How can I view closed captions for a video that is in a course?
Answer:
1. In the bottom right hand corner of the video there are two small letter 'Cs' (CC).
![Image of the bottom of a video, the navigation bar, with a red square in the bottom right highlighting two letter Cs](https://branded.teamdynamix.com/TDPortal/Images/Viewer?fileName=5f9cd04c-631b-4001-bc92-bab54e194461.png)
2. If you click on the two Cs, you will see a menu pop up.
![Image of video navigation bar. A red square highlights the CC dropdown menu. The options are "English" or "Off"](https://branded.teamdynamix.com/TDPortal/Images/Viewer?fileName=d6b72ce2-b6af-4155-a8c8-c090261772ce.png)
3. Select "English" and the captioning will appear on the bottom of the screen in English.
